7. A 50 foot rope is cut into two pieces, one long piece and one short piece. The length of the long piece

Mathematics
1 answer:
Lapatulllka [165]3 years ago
4 0

Answer:

Short piece: 9 ft

Long piece: 41 ft

Step-by-step explanation:

The first step to solving this problem is to translate the given information into some equations. Since we know the total length of the rope is 50 feet, the solution when adding the equation for the short piece and the equation for the long piece must be 50. The information from the second sentence can be translated into a mathematical expression. The phrase "5 more than 4 times" has two key words. They are "times" and "more". "Times" implies multiplication while "more" implies addition. Therefore this sentence becomes the expressions 5+4x, where x is the length of the short piece.

The equations we have from the problem statement are:

L = 5+4x where L represents the length of the long piece and x represents the length of the short piece

x + L = 50

Substituting the equation for the long piece into the equation for total length:

x + (5+4x) = 50

5 + 5x = 50

5x = 45

x = 9 ft

Substituting x = 9 into the equation for the long piece:

L = 5 + 4(9)

L = 5 + 36

L = 41 ft

Checking the answers by substituting x = 9 and L = 41 into the equation for total length:

x + L = 50

9 + 41 = 50

50 = 50

In your quilt shop,you make and sell quilts. You like to have a total of 26 yards of royal blue fabric in stock at the beginning
Vera_Pavlovna [14]

Answer:

7 pieces

Step-by-step explanation:

Stock that must be available at the beginning of each month = 26 yards

Since,

1 yard = 36 inches

26 yards = 26 x 36 = 936 inches

This means 936 inches of fabric must be available at beginning of each month.

<u>Current Inventory:</u>

4 pieces that are each 22 1/2 (or 22.5) inches long. So total length of these fabrics =  4 x 22.5 = 90 inches

3 pieces that each 33 inches long. So total length of these fabrics = 3 x 33 = 99 inches

Therefore, the total length of current inventory = 90 + 99 = 189 inches.

<u>Length of fabric needed more:</u>

Length of fabric that must be bought more = 936 - 189 = 747 inches

It is given that the fabric must be bought in pieces are the 3 yards long. 3 yards is equal to 108 inches.

So,  I have to buy pieces that are each 108 inches long and I need to complete 747 inches in total.

Therefore, the number of pieces that I need to buy = \frac{747}{108}=6.9

Since, the pieces cannot be bought in fraction, I need to buy 7 complete pieces to replenish my stock.
